Skip to main content
SMC Students homeSchedule of Classes home
Class

CS-> CS 87B: Advanced Python Programming

This course builds on a first level course in Python exposing students to more advanced topics and applications to industry. Topics cover object-oriented programming, creating classes and using objects, web applications, and some common libraries and their functions used for data manipulation. Students may use either a PC (Windows) or a Mac (Linux) to complete their programming assignments.
  • Prerequisites:
    CS 87A.
  • Credits:
    3 units
  • Notes:
    Transfer: UC,CSU

Fall 2025

  • ARRANGE-4.5Hours | Jinan Darwiche | Online
    CS-> CS 87B-1770
    Online
  • ARRANGE-4.5Hours | Jinan Darwiche | Online
    CS-> CS 87B-1771
    Online